Storytel Group Reports Record Profitability and Strong Cash Generation in The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2025
STOKHOLM, SE / ACCESS Newswire / February 11, 2026 / Storytel AB (publ) (STO:STORY B) - "Our integrated streaming and publishing strategy delivered record profitability and cash flow generation for 2025. As we enter 2026, we are focused on scaling this momentum by leveraging AI-driven innovation to lead the future of storytelling", says Bodil Eriksson Torp, CEO Storytel Group.
Q4 Highlights
Revenue growth of +12% in constant exchange rates (CER)
Streaming revenues +10% at CER
Publishing revenues +13% at CER
Gross margin of 47.0% (46.4%)
Adjusted EBITDA margin of 20.0% (18.6%)
Recognition of deferred tax asset, impact of +195 MSEK on net profit
Net profit for the period amounted to 300 (149) MSEK
EPS of 4.53 (1.82), diluted
Net cash position of 136 MSEK, end of Q4'25
January-December Highlights
Revenue growth of +9% in constant exchange rates (CER)
Streaming revenues +8% at CER
Publishing revenues +15% at CER
Gross margin of 45.6% (44.8%)
Adjusted EBITDA margin of 18.8% (15.8%)
Recognition of deferred tax asset, impact of 195 MSEK on net profit
Net profit of 504 (213) MSEK
EPS of 6.22 (2.54), diluted
Proposed dividend of SEK 1.50 for 2025
Initiated process for listing on Nasdaq Stockholm Main Market during 2026
Financial summary
MSEK | Q4 2025 | Q4 2024 | Change | Jan-Dec 2025 | Jan-Dec 2024 | Change |
Group Revenue¹ | 1,098 | 1,028 | 7% | 4,023 | 3,798 | 6% |
Streaming Revenue² | 918 | 879 | 5% | 3,518 | 3,377 | 4% |
Publishing Revenue³ | 367 | 332 | 11% | 1,274 | 1,125 | 13% |
Gross profit | 516 | 477 | 8% | 1,833 | 1,700 | 8% |
Gross margin % | 47.0 | 46.4 | 0.6p | 45.6 | 44.8 | 0.8p |
Operating profit | 134 | 136 | -1% | 423 | 246 | 72% |
Adjusted EBITDA | 220 | 192 | 15% | 757 | 602 | 26% |
Adjusted EBITDA margin % | 20.0 | 18.6 | 1.4p | 18.8 | 15.8 | 3.0p |
EBITDA | 220 | 223 | -1% | 747 | 544 | 37% |
Earnings per share, basic (SEK) | 4.56 | 1.83 | 149% | 6.26 | 2.55 | 145% |
Earnings per share, diluted (SEK) | 4.53 | 1.82 | 149% | 6.22 | 2.54 | 145% |
Cash flow from operations before changes in working capital | 217 | 232 | -6% | 647 | 514 | 26% |
Cash flow for the period | 163 | 164 | -1% | 86 | 175 | -51% |
Net Interest-Bearing Debt (NIBD) | -136 | 27 | -604% | -136 | 27 | -604% |
NIBD/adjusted R12 EBITDA ratio | -0.18 | 0.05 | -428% | -0.18 | 0.05 | -428% |

About Storytel Group
We are a storytelling company. Driven by our purpose - "Leading the future of storytelling, we move the world through stories" - Storytel Group inspires and entertains people around the world by blending innovation with tradition. We bring stories to life across various formats for everyone to discover. Anytime. Anywhere.
Storytel Group operates in two business areas: Streaming and Publishing. The streaming service is one of the largest audiobook and e-book services, offering more than 1.8 million titles, in 55 languages to more than 2.6 million subscribers under the brands Storytel, Mofibo and Audiobooks.com. Through the Publishing unit, we deliver high-quality stories from acclaimed authors across numerous genres via renowned publishing houses such as Bokfabriken, Gummerus, Lind & Co, Norstedts Publishing Group, People's and Storyside. The headquarters are located in Stockholm, Sweden.
